The first thing you must never accept is disrespect. Disrespect is not only someone shouting at you or showing contempt with their eyes. Disrespect happens when someone diminishes your value, tears down your faith, and treats you as though the God within you is insignificant and powerless. Each time you allow someone to speak to you in a way that crushes your spirit, you are quietly telling them, "This is acceptable. Do it again." No, my friend, this is where you draw the boundary. God does not call his children to bow beneath the disrespect of others. If someone cannot honor you, if they refuse to treat you with the dignity God himself has placed on your life, then you are not required to keep their presence close to you. The approval of God carries far more weight than the acceptance of people.

Another behavior you must never make peace with is deception. Lies destroy trust, and trust is the foundation of every relationship, whether with family, friends, or those around you in daily life. God is a god of truth. He works in the light, never in darkness. And when you choose to surround yourself with liars, you are choosing to stay near people who live and move in darkness. And darkness will always try to pull you down to its level. It will twist your thinking, make you question your own discernment, and slowly erode your peace. If someone lies to you once, and you see no repentance, no change, then understand this is not a safe place for your heart. Protect the truth in your life the way you would protect a flame in the middle of a storm.

The third behavior you must never tolerate is manipulation. There are people who will use your kindness against you. They will twist your compassion into a leash they can pull anytime they want. They know your heart is soft, and they prey on it. But hear me, God gave you a heart of mercy, not a heart of slavery. Manipulators will drain you, not because they cannot carry their own burdens, but because they know you will always pick them up. And if you keep allowing it, you will one day wake up too exhausted to carry the assignment God has given you. Love people, yes, but do not let that love become a chain around your own neck.

Another behavior to never tolerate is disloyalty. Loyalty is not just about being present when life is good. Loyalty is about standing with someone when the wind is against them. When their name is being dragged. When the road gets hard. But there are those who smile in your face and stand in your shadow. Yet the moment the storm comes, they disappear. Or worse, they stand with your enemies. My friend, God himself warns about double-minded people. Those who speak one way and act another. When someone shows you they cannot be trusted with your name, your secrets, or your struggle, believe them. Do not give your heart to people who have already proven it means nothing to them.

The fifth behavior you must never tolerate is constant criticism without love. We all need correction, but correction from God always comes with the warmth of his love and the goal of your growth. But there are people who criticize not to help you, but to break you. They point out your flaws, magnify your mistakes, and speak death over your dreams. They do not see the good in you because their heart is not aligned with God's heart. If you keep such voices close, you will begin to believe their words more than God's promises. Silence those voices because the only voice that deserves to define you is the voice of the almighty.

And finally, never tolerate abuse, whether physical, emotional, or spiritual. Abuse is not love. It is not patience. It is not just how they are. It is evil. It is a violation of the boundaries God has set for how his children should be treated. If you are enduring abuse and convincing yourself that it's your duty to stay, hear me now. God does not want you bound to harm. He has called you to peace. He has called you to safety. Walking away from abuse is not rebellion. It is obedience to the truth that you are worthy of protection.
